According to hvg.hu, Sándor Csányi is back on Forbes’ top list of billionaires. In fact, he is the chairman and CEO of OTP Group, one of the biggest financial services firms in Central and Eastern Europe. Based on the list, he is the 1999th richest person in the world with 1.1 billion dollars.

Csányi returned after 2016

Forbes published its newest list containing the world’s wealthiest people. According to them, there are 2,208 billionaires in the world, and their altogether fortune is worth 9.1 thousand billion dollars. This hard-to-imagine sum is 18% more than it was a year before. This supports the concept that more and

more private capital is accumulating in ever fewer hands.

Compared to the 2017 list there are 259 new names on it. In fact, most of the billionaires are American (585) while the silver medal belongs to the Chinese with 373 names.

According to their calculations, the Hungarian OTP-CEO Sándor Csányi has 1.1 billion HUF. This fortune was enough for the 1999th place. Interestingly,

Csányi was among the wealthiest people in 2016.

However, last year his money was not enough.

According to Forbes, the wealthiest person in the world at present is Jeff Bezos, founder of Amazon online marketplace. Based on their estimates, his fortune is 112 billion dollars. This means that he earned 39.2 billion dollars in the last 12 months. In fact, he was in the third place last year.
